Amita Patni Appointed as Vice President, Global Procurement Head at Shalina Healthcare

Amita Patni Appointed as Vice President, Global Procurement Head at Shalina Healthcare

Mumbai, Maharashtra, India, May 2026 – Shalina Healthcare has appointed Amita Patni as Vice President, Global Procurement Head, bringing extensive expertise in strategic sourcing, procurement leadership, supply chain management, and global commercial operations across the pharmaceutical and agrochemical sectors.

With significant experience spanning APIs, excipients, packaging materials, formulations, bulk chemicals, and direct procurement operations, Amita Patni has built a strong leadership career across multinational pharmaceutical, specialty chemical, and healthcare organizations.

Prior to joining Shalina Healthcare, Amita Patni served as Category Lead – Global Procurement (Direct Spend) at Sudarshan Chemical Industries Ltd., where she led procurement initiatives focused on direct materials and strategic sourcing operations for global business requirements.

Earlier, she worked with Laxmi Organic Industries Ltd. as Vice President Procurement, where she played a key role in procurement strategy, supplier management, sourcing optimization, and strengthening commercial operations across the organization.

Before that, Amita spent nearly six years with Teva Pharmaceuticals as Associate Director – Direct Materials, leading procurement operations for pharmaceutical direct materials and strengthening sourcing capabilities across critical supply categories. She also worked with UPL as Senior Manager – Strategic Sourcing, where she handled sourcing strategy and supplier partnerships within the agrochemical and industrial sectors.

A significant part of her early leadership journey was with GSK, where she spent over six years across multiple procurement and supply chain roles including Procurement Manager (Global Role), Procurement Manager, and Assistant Manager – Sourcing Group (External Supply). During her tenure, she also contributed to GSK’s global supply chain transformation initiatives and strategic sourcing programs across international markets.

On the academic front, Amita Patni holds an MBA in Finance from SPJIMR SP Jain Institute of Management & Research.

About Shalina Healthcare

Shalina Healthcare is a leading healthcare company focused on making quality healthcare products affordable and accessible across Africa. Headquartered in Dubai, the company has built a strong presence across multiple African markets through its pharmaceutical, consumer healthcare, and diagnostics businesses.

Operating for more than four decades, Shalina Healthcare sources products from WHO-approved manufacturing facilities and leverages a strong distribution network across Africa. Its portfolio includes over 450 products across therapeutic categories including anti-malarials, antibiotics, anti-inflammatory medicines, nutrition products, hygiene solutions, and diagnostic services.
